Speedometer not working, bad gas milage 95 2.5 liter
Hello all,
hoping someone could help me with my speedometer. It started cutting out and jumping around about 2 weeks ago, also occasionally it would jump without moving like sitting at a stop sign. It finally gave out and doesn't work at all now. Just wondering if there are some simple things I could check first? Also my gas milage went to crap the begining of winter, I'd say around 16/19 and I was getting 20/25 before that. I took it to a mechanic and they said the o2 sensor is working and that it doesn't appear to have any problems, in fact he told me the truck runs great. One last thing....when you shut the hood to the truck it will stutter and try to stall out, we found that it was the computer that was causing it...basically just tap it down where the hose comes out the bottom. Could all these problems be related? Like I said, the truck runs great and other than the speedometer and gas milage, haven't had any problems
it's a 95 dakota 2.5liter, manual tranny, 113k miles
thanks for any suggestions

Ok, went to pick up a speed sensor at my local parts store and he said there was a speed sensor and a speed output sensor. The output sensor basically looks like a big spark plug with threading to screw into somewhere? I can't figure out where it goes. I climbed under the truck and found the speed sensor on the tranny but have no idea where this output sensor goes. been trying to find some pics online but no luck yet. The parts guy told me to start with the output sensor since it was only 16.00 bucks and easy to install. If that doesn't do it than it's on the the speed sensor.
Anyone know where the "output sensor" is located?
Thanks again for the help, I am deffinetly not a mechanic but have been trying to do some of this stuff on my own to learn.

Found out there is no output sensor on my truck (think it's for a auto tranny) I replaced the speed sensor and no luck with the speedo. My guess is that it is a electrical problem. I pulled off the computer and followed the wires into their port, they are all in tight and doesn't appear to be loose.
pulled the speedo off to look at it and see how it works. Also went to my local dodge dealer to see how much a new speedo was.....400 bucks!!!
Does anyone know if there is a way to have one overhauled? I don't wanna put in a new speedo with incorrect odometer. I've seen some clusters on Ebay for cheap, but they all have a significant more amount of miles. If I ever sell the truck I don't wanna have to explain why the truck only has 113k miles but the odometer says 200 somthing.
